Khaleda starts 4 dist visit Thursday

Khaleda Zia is scheduled to visit four districts during this month and November as part of the countrywide mass campaign of BNP-led 20-party alliance to drum up public support for an inclusive fresh election under a non-party administration.

The first two rallies will be held in Nilphamari and Natore on Thursday and October 30 while the last two rallies will be staged in Comilla on November 6 or 7 and in Kishoreganj on November 12.

The announcement came after a meeting of secretary generals of the components in the 20-party alliance held in the capital's BNP's Naya Paltan central office.

Meeting sources said BNP acting secretary general Mirza Fakhrul assured the alliance leaders that the BNP chief is likely to announce tougher programmes following her meeting with chiefs of the components after Nov 12.

About the sedition case filed by Bangabandhu Foundation President advocate Moshiur Malek against BNP Senior Vice Chairman Tarique Rahman, Fakhrul said it was filed on false charges with an instigation by the "current illegal regime".

The BNP leader demanded that the "false" case be withdrawn immediately.

Fakhrul also told reporters that the alliance would also wage a movement if the government increased price of power and gas tariffs.
